Microcredential mCOSIB – Algorithm Engineering

Beschreibung

Theoretical (worst case) runtimes of algorithms often do not explain their be-havior in practice sufficiently. The input data, the hardware architecture, hidden constants and many other factors influence empirical runtimes. Algorithm Engi-neering tries to bridge this gap between theory and practice. The goal is to design algorithms which work well on real-world data, are simple and easy to implement and take the used hardware into account (e.g. provide good data locality). In the lecture, we will discuss AE approaches for several important applications as sorting, graph partitioning/clustering, route planning and NP-hard problems as TSP, Independent Set and Colouring. We will compare dif-ferent algorithms on real-world benchmarks, try to identify 'hard inputs' and discuss performance measures which can be compared in a hardware-independent way.
